Crystal structure of human adenosine A2A receptor with an allosteric inverse-agonist antibody at 3.1 A resolution
X-RAY DIFFRACTION
Starting Model(s)
| Initial Refinement Model(s) | |||
|---|---|---|---|
| Type | Source | Accession Code | Details |
| experimental model | PDB | 1VGA | PDB ENTRY 1VGA |
Crystallization
| Crystalization Experiments | ||||
|---|---|---|---|---|
| ID | Method | pH | Temperature | Details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 6.5 | 293 | 30% PEG 400, 0.1M MES, 0.2M magnesium chloride, 0.5% octhyl thioglucoside , pH 6.5, VAPOR DIFFUSION, HANGING DROP, temperature 293K |
| Crystal Properties | |
|---|---|
| Matthews coefficient | Solvent content |
| 3.53 | 65.12 |
Crystal Data
| Unit Cell | |
|---|---|
| Length ( Å ) | Angle ( ˚ ) |
| a = 120.313 | α = 90 |
| b = 89.766 | β = 96.14 |
| c = 110.682 | γ = 90 |
| Symmetry | |
|---|---|
| Space Group | C 1 2 1 |
